Unplug in our gorgeous barn loft above our working barn. Sleep to the sound of crickets and frogs in the pond, then wake up and pet the sheep, goats, rabbits, cats, ducks & chickens. Open floor plan, cathedral ceiling, farm decor, fire pole, sliding barn doors. Full kitchen, jetted tub, rain shower, laundry. Stone patio, fire pit. 2 bedrooms, sleeper sofa, air mattresses. Juice, coffee, and fresh eggs provided when the hens are laying. NO A/C. ABSOLUTELY NO PETS

The space
The loft is above a working barn so visiting our sweet animals is a special treat. We don't have a rooster crowing but you might hear the sheep baa-ing to greet the morning as they head out of the barn.
Guest access
The entire loft apartment is available to you, along with the patio and fire pit. You are welcome to go downstairs and visit the animals in and around the barn. You may also ramble through the woods and down to the pond.

Argyle, Wisconsin, United States
We have 24 acres with woods, a pond and pasture. The woods are filled with wildlife, including a pair of young does born this spring. Bring sturdy boots and clothes and go on a woods ramble (especially fun during summer wild raspberry season!) plus, our farm animals are friendly and love attention.
Blanchardville, Argyle, New Glarus, Mt Horeb and Monroe are all nearby with Saturday farm markets, river tubing, local brewery tours, excellent restaurants and lots of interesting shops. We would be happy to offer recommendations if you like. Madison is 45 minutes away, too.
Also, Yellowstone Lake State Park is 15 miles away, offering all season hiking and fishing, and boating or swimming in warm weather.
